Optically Transparent Wood: Recent Progress, Opportunities, and Challenges

摘要

Transparent wood is an emerging load-bearing material reinvented fromrnnatural wood scaffolds with added light management functionalities. Suchrnmaterial shows promising properties for buildings and related structuralrnapplications, including its renewable and abundant origin, interesting opticalrnproperties, outstanding mechanical performance, low density, low thermalrnconductivity, and great potential for multifunctionalization. In this study, arndetailed summary of recent progress on the transparent wood research topicrnis presented. Remaining questions and challenges related to transparentrnwood preparation, optical property measurements, and transparent woodrnmodification and applications are discussed.
